The Sufrin File: A leader on and off the field ... Had a breakout year in 2007 ... A quick player who works well off-ball … Sees the field well ... Has earned Third Team Preseason All-America honors from Face-off Yearbook.
2007: Named a USILA Honorable Mention All-American … Finished third on the team in goals (28) and tied for second in assists (15) … Scored seven goals in the NCAA Tournament, netting four against Tufts and three versus Ithaca … Also posted three goals in the Bullets’ 12-11 Centennial Conference semifinal win over Haverford, and against Washington (Md.) on April 7.
2006: Appeared in six games ... Netted his first career goal at Susquehanna on March 15 ... Scored two points on a goal and an assist against McDaniel on April 19.
2005: Played in seven games... Made his collegiate debut in the season opener at then-No. 8 Washington & Lee on March 5.
High School: An all-county selection and co-captain at Mahopac H.S., where he also played basketball.
Personal: Cousin, Mike Mohoric, played football at New Mexico ... Majoring in management.
